With a 69% increase in internet crime in 2020 and a 40-60% chance that a small business will never reopen after data loss , both cyber security and cyber resilience are critical to a company’s endgame. In a 2020 survey, 89% of Americans thought they were good at cybersecurity but only 10% received an ‘A’ grade.
